How RCSB PDB Data Bank Actually Works
At its core, the RCSB PDB Data Bank is a centralized repository of three-dimensional structures of molecules, including proteins, nucleic acids, and complexes. These structures are obtained through X-ray crystallography, NMR spectroscopy, and other experimental techniques, providing a comprehensive picture of molecular interactions and relationships. With a vast collection of over 170,000 structures, the Data Bank is an invaluable resource for researchers seeking to better understand the intricacies of molecular biology.

**Q: What does RCSB PDB Data Bank mean?**A: RCSB PDB Data Bank is an acronym for Research Collaboratory for Structural Bioinformatics Protein Data Bank, a comprehensive database of molecular structures.
**Q: Is the Data Bank free to access?**A: Yes, the RCSB PDB Data Bank is an open-access resource, allowing anyone with an internet connection to explore and utilize its vast database of protein structures.

Things People Often Misunderstand
**Myth 1: The RCSB PDB Data Bank is solely for academic researchers.**A: While the Data Bank is often used in academic settings, it's an open-access resource suitable for anyone interested in molecular structures and biology.
Myth 2: The Data Bank contains only 3D structures of proteins. A: While the Data Bank is primarily known for its protein structures, it also contains nucleic acids and complexes, offering a more comprehensive understanding of molecular relationships.
**Myth 3: The RCSB PDB Data Bank is a replacement for traditional research methods.**A: Rather, the Data Bank is a valuable supplement to traditional research methods, providing a wealth of information and insights to inform and guide scientific inquiry.
